LEGO Collectible Minifigure Series 3: The Fisherman


The Fisherman is exclusive to set 8803, The Collectible Minifigure Series 3.

Minifigure Parts and Accessories
The Fisherman is composed of five main parts: stocking cap, head, beard, torso, and legs.

The stocking cap is a dark blue variant of part 41334, a new color for this part.


The head print is new and even features a white beard. Strange given the beard element that comes with it.


The beard is a new part in white. The attachment is via the head post.

The torso and arms are blue with yellow hands. The torso print resembles an yellow-orange pair of fishing coveralls.

The legs and hips are yellow-orange with no visible print.


There are two accessories that come with this figure - a black fishing pole and a sand green fish. The fishing pole is a new part, while the fish is in a new color.

Army Building Potential
The ABP for the figure is low - outside of filling out a series 3 collection, this figure is not likely to be sought in multiples.

Feeling It Out
The fishing pole should be easy to identify by feeling it through the bag.

Bar Codes
Unlike previous series of collectible minifigures, there will be no secondary bar codes to help determine what figure is inside. However, there are a series of 'bumps' on the bottom of the packages that can be used to identify the contents (LEGO Series 3 Collectible Minifigure Codes). The Big Draw
Due to the uniqueness of the fishing pole, it may have an attraction. The fish and stocking cap in new colors might be of interest. This biggest draw here may be the new beard design.
